Jogging routes around Schruns offer a diverse landscape for runners, nestled within Austria's Montafon Valley. The region is characterized by three distinct mountain ranges—Verwall, Silvretta, and Rätikon—providing varied terrain from gentle alpine meadows to more challenging mountainous paths. The Ill River and Litz Bach also create opportunities for scenic, flatter runs along river promenades, while many trails weave through picturesque forests and alpine meadows.

Along the straightened Litz river near Schruns, two beautiful gravel paths run along both sides, lined with lovely old houses and trees. A must for both walkers and cyclists. One is called the Hermann Sander Trail, the other the Doktor Vonbun Trail.

Schruns offers a wide variety of running experiences, with over 45 routes documented on komoot. These range from easy valley runs to more challenging mountain trails, catering to all fitness levels.
Jogging routes in Schruns feature diverse terrain. You'll find scenic paths along the Ill River and Litz Bach, through tranquil alpine meadows and forests, and more challenging ascents in the Verwall, Silvretta, and Rätikon mountain ranges. The region is known for its varied natural landscapes.
Yes, Schruns has several easy running routes per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ed run. For instance, the 'Schrunser Round' is an easy, mostly flat option, much of which is illuminated at night. You can also find 6 easy routes on komoot, with many more moderate options that are accessible.
The running trails in Schruns are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.4 stars from over 50 reviews. Runners often praise the diverse terrain, well-marked paths, and the stunning natural beauty of the Montafon Valley.
Absolutely. Schruns is situated on the Ill River and near the Litz Bach, offering beautiful river promenades. A great option is the Schruns Train Station – View of the River in Montafon loop from Schruns, which provides extensive river views. The Bürser Gorge also offers a unique, almost jungle-like landscape with the Alvierbach stream.
The summer months, typically from June to September, are ideal for jogging in Schruns. The mild temperatures and vibrant natural landscapes make for a comfortable and visually stunning outdoor experience. The extensive trail network is fully accessible during this period.
Yes, many of the running routes around Schruns are designed as circular lo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the Beautiful path along the Ill – Covered Bridge Over the Ill loop from Tschagguns is a challenging circular route offering picturesque views.
Yes, the region has several mountain huts, such as the Wormser Hut and Freiburger Hut, which are often located at scenic points along longer routes and serve as welcoming stops for refreshments. In Schruns itself, you'll find various cafes and restaurants.
Schruns offers numerous scenic points. You can access higher elevation trails with panoramic views via the Hochjochbahn Cable Car. Highlights like the Golmer Joch summit cross or the Sulzfluh Summit offer breathtaking vistas, though reaching them might involve more challenging terrain suitable for experienced runners or hikers.
Many of the flatter, less strenuous paths along the river promenades and through alpine meadows are suitable for families. The 'Schrunser Round' is an easy option. For families with prams, stick to wider, paved or well-maintained gravel paths, as some mountain trails can be uneven.
Schruns is well-connected, and many routes are accessible directly from the town center, including near the train station. For routes starting further afield, there are often designated parking areas. Public transport, such as local buses, can also provide access to various trailheads throughout the Montafon Valley.
